  • Patent number: 5228116
    Abstract: An inference engine in a knowledge base system may be invoked by an application program (e.g., a COBOL program), by arranging to detect, in the program, instructions whose syntax complies with the syntax requirements of a predefined data base manipulation language (e.g., SQL), and then executing the instruction by invoking the inference engine. As a result, the application programmer can implicitly and transparently take full advantage of the facilities of the inference engine using simple, known data base manipulation language statements.
